Partager via


MediaCapture.FindAllVideoProfiles(String) Méthode

Définition

Récupère la liste de tous les profils vidéo pris en charge par l’appareil de capture vidéo spécifié.

public:
 static IVectorView<MediaCaptureVideoProfile ^> ^ FindAllVideoProfiles(Platform::String ^ videoDeviceId);
 static IVectorView<MediaCaptureVideoProfile> FindAllVideoProfiles(winrt::hstring const& videoDeviceId);
public static IReadOnlyList<MediaCaptureVideoProfile> FindAllVideoProfiles(string videoDeviceId);
function findAllVideoProfiles(videoDeviceId)
Public Shared Function FindAllVideoProfiles (videoDeviceId As String) As IReadOnlyList(Of MediaCaptureVideoProfile)

Paramètres

videoDeviceId
String

Platform::String

winrt::hstring

Identificateur de l’appareil vidéo pour lequel les profils vidéo pris en charge sont interrogés. Pour plus d’informations sur l’obtention de l’ID d’appareil vidéo, consultez DeviceInformation.FindAllAsync.

Retours

Liste des profils vidéo pris en charge par l’appareil de capture vidéo spécifié.

Configuration requise pour Windows

Fonctionnalités de l’application
backgroundMediaRecording

Remarques

Avant d’appeler cette méthode, appelez IsVideoProfileSupported pour vous assurer que l’appareil de capture prend en charge les profils vidéo.

Utilisez FindKnownVideoProfiles pour demander des profils avec des fonctionnalités spécifiques à l’aide de l’une des valeurs KnownVideoProfile .

Pour obtenir des conseils pratiques sur l’utilisation des profils d’appareil photo, consultez Découvrir et sélectionner des fonctionnalités d’appareil photo avec des profils d’appareil photo.

S’applique à

Voir aussi